Göran Bertilsson is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Oncology and General Health Professions. According to data from OpenAlex, Göran Bertilsson has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 2.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Molecular Biology, 4 papers in Oncology and 4 papers in General Health Professions. Recurrent topics in Göran Bertilsson’s work include Pharmacogenetics and Drug Metabolism (3 papers), Drug Transport and Resistance Mechanisms (3 papers) and Gestational Diabetes Research and Management (2 papers). Göran Bertilsson is often cited by papers focused on Pharmacogenetics and Drug Metabolism (3 papers), Drug Transport and Resistance Mechanisms (3 papers) and Gestational Diabetes Research and Management (2 papers). Göran Bertilsson coll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, United States and Norway. Göran Bertilsson's co-authors include Anders Berkenstam, Kristian Svensson, Lena Jendeberg, Patrik Blomquist, Rolf Ohlsson, Hans Postlind, Yihai Cao, Yuichi Makino, Hirotoshi Tanaka and Renhai Cao and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Journal of Biological Chemistry.
